Certified Nursing Assistant Salary in Lacey, WA: $50,764 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time certified nursing assistant in Lacey, WA earns a median $50,764/year (≈ $24.41/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 31-1131). Once you factor in Lacey's price level (7% above national, BEA RPP 107.4), that paycheck buys what $47,266 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.8% below the Washington state average.

Salary Trajectory for Certified Nursing Assistants in Lacey (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 6.50%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$33,454 | Actual |
| 2020 | $34,796 | Actual |
| 2021 | $34,187 | Actual |
| 2022 | $40,335 | Actual |
| 2023 | $43,087 | Actual |
| 2024 | $46,400 | Actual |
| 2025 | $47,666 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$50,764 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$54,064 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Lacey metropolitan area, the median certified nursing assistant salary grew 42.5% from $33,454 (2019) to $47,666 (2025). At a 6.50%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$54,064 by 2027 — a total increase of $20,610 (61.61%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Lacey met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 6.50%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Actual salaries may vary based on employer, experience, certifications, and local market conditions.

Certified Nursing Assistant Job Market in Lacey
Lacey's job market currently has 12 certified nursing assistants employed, reflecting a niche but essential workforce. The area's cost-of-living index of 107.4 indicates that while salaries are higher than the national average, the purchasing power may be somewhat tempered due to elevated living expenses. Among local employers, skilled nursing facilities and rehabilitation hospitals typically offer the most competitive pay, influenced by factors such as shift differentials, where evening and weekend hours can command an additional $1 to $4 per hour. Additionally, CNAs with CMA certification can often secure stipends that enhance their earnings. To maximize pay in this Lacey market, aspiring CNAs could consider shifts that fall during peak hours, actively seek weekend roles, or position themselves in facilities with high acuity patients, as these factors significantly influence overall compensation.
